What do folks think?  I know it's many months away, but there is no longer-format cricket for Indians to play till then.  I don't think any of them are playing in the English county season.  Given that (forgetting for a moment the Indian history of choosing test teams based on shorter-format performance) what would the squad look like.  I am assuming a squad of 17: three openers, six middle order bats, two keepers, four medium pacers, and two spinners.  

For starters, spin:  Jadeja?  Surely not in the place of Ojha?  How else?  Surely not as a middle order bat!
Openers:  Vijay and Dhawan have both done enough to go, Gambhir as the third (to back up as early middle order if needed)
Middle order:  Pujara, Kohli and unless he retires, Tendulkar, are given.  Who will be the other three?  Rahane and Raina, going by current selections, but Rahane hasn't been too impressive in his single innings to date and Raina has a history of weakness against pace.  Tiwary and possibly Rohit Sharma are the other contenders. Could Nayar be a possibility?
Medium pacers:  Bhuvaneshwar and probably Ishant certainly. Yadav, of course, if he is fit.  Who else?  Zaheer?  Pathan or Shami? Could Punjab's Sid Kaul or Sandeep Sharma make it? Ishwar Pandey?  

Would like the opinions of those who are closer to domestic cricket than I am!
